Windshield repair, anyone ever heard of this?
Took my 2015 Anthem to Safelite to get 3 bullseyes repaired. The Technician repaired all three and then told me that federal law states that windshields can only be repaired 3 times and then the windshield must be replaced. He said he wasn't sure about RV's and I should check with my insurance company. Anyone ever heard of this? BTW I've had 5 chips repaired on this windshield, all less than the size of a quarter. My insurance company was not aware of that on RV's.

Safelite states on their web site they'll repair up to 3 chips per visit. Since time is money I suspect its because if there's more than 3 to repair its more cost effective to just replace the windshield as the cost of commonly available windshields is not all that high. Exceptions to this rule would be expensive windshields found on some luxury cars, exotic cars, large motorhomes, etc. Windshield demand for such vehicles are small so the cost of small production runs pushes the unit price up.
Companies that do windshield repair are pretty confident in their work as very few fail so if an occasional repair does fail they'll just eat the replacement cost. Their work is not covered by insurance. The occasional replacement is simply factored in as a cost of doing business.
If your insurance policy includes glass coverage then insurance providers are willing to waive the deductible and pay for the whole repair as it saves them money IF there are not too many to repair.

Actually, my paperwork from Safelite states that if the chip repair fails, they will refund the cost of the repair. Does not say that they will replace the windshield.
"In the very rare event that this occurs, we will credit the cost of the repair either toward a new windshield or, in the event of insurance work, back to the insurance company. Read our windshield repair limited warranty for more details."
